The project team is inspecting the completed project scope to determine if the requirements have been satisfied. What is the result of this inspection?
Answer options
- A. Accepted deliverables
- B. Planning packages
- C. Verified deliverables
- D. Work packages
Correct answer: C
Explanation
The correct answer is C, 'Verified deliverables', because this term refers to the outputs that have been checked and confirmed to meet the specified requirements. Options A, B, and D do not accurately describe the result of the inspection; 'Accepted deliverables' are those that have been approved, 'Planning packages' are components of project planning, and 'Work packages' are parts of the project breakdown structure.
